Job Summary

To perform a variety of specialized departmental clerical duties and responsibilities within the assigned department.

Job Description

Department: Clerk of Courts

Sub-Department: N/A

Pay Grade: 104

FLSA Status: Non-Exempt

Employment Status: Full Time

Reports to: Second Deputy

Supervises: N/A

Job Summary

To perform a variety of specialized departmental clerical duties and responsibilities within the assigned department.

Essential Job Functions

  • Completes assigned juvenile workload.
  • Creates and processes incoming case packets.
  • Distribute, docket in computerized case management system, scan, and file all correspondence and documents filed with the department.
  • Answers telephone and takes messages or transfers calls to proper individuals.
  • Greets and assists general public by taking or providing information, receiving payments or directing them to proper locations.
  • Prepares and processes required department documents, forms and reports as required.
  • Operates computer, scanner, copier and other office equipment as needed.
  • Expunges cases when ordered by the Court.
  • Attends meetings and/or training sessions as required.
  • Performs other job-related duties as required.

Education

Minimum Requirements to Perform the Work:

  • High school diploma or equivalent plus some additional secretarial and computer training.

Work Experience

  • 3-5 years working experience in an office setting and with the public preferred.
  • Proficient in data entry/typing.
  • Legal experience a plus.

Benefits

Medical Benefits:

  • Capital Blue Cross Medical Insurance
    • Health Savings Account
    • Wellness program with wellness incentives
  • Capital Blue Cross Vision Insurance
  • United Concordia Dental Insurance
Retirement Benefits

  • County Retirement Pension
    • 5% minimum pre-tax contribution required, with the option of increasing your contribution over 5% up to 15% post-tax
    • Fully vested after 5 years of credited service
    • Normal Retirement Options:
      • Age 55 with 20 years of credited service
      • Age 60 with any amount of credited service
  • Voluntary 457b Deferred Compensation Plan
  • Military Time Buy Back Options
Paid Time Off

  • Vacation
    • 10 days per year, accrued per pay period (Non-Exempt)
    • 15 days per year, accrued per pay period (Exempt)
    • Increase for both Non-Exempt and Exempt of 5 days per year after 2 years of service
  • Personal
    • 3 Personal days per year, pro-rated based on starting date
  • Sick
    • 5 Sick days per year, pro-rated based on starting date
  • 12 Paid County Holidays
    • No waiting period to receive paid holidays
Additional Benefits

  • Educational Assistance
    • 80% of cost of tuition and books up to the annual IRS limit per calendar year (after 6 months of Full-Time Employment)
  • Public Service Loan Forgiveness (PSLF) – certain eligibility requirements must be met
  • Employee Assistance Program
    • Resources for: Childcare, Eldercare, Legal, Financial, and Coaching
  • Flexible Spending Account
  • Dependent Care Account
  • Short Term Disability
  • Long Term Disability
  • Life Insurance
